I hesitate to write this review because this waterfront hotel with stunning views is a tranquil, peaceful, hidden gem which I would rather the rest of the world didn't discover! But they deserve these accolades and more, so here goes:
This is a family-owned place and the pride of ownership shows. It is spotless, as they are constantly cleaning. Nothing is too much to ask and they will organize whatever you want (such as snorkeling trips, cars, etc). They will do laundry for you at $6 per load. Massages were amazing at $12 per hour. Their chef is just spectacular (lots of people from other resorts were coming to eat) and she will give you a private cooking class at $25 per person, which includes your meal. (Be sure to try her "hot ginger fish"---it's unbelievable.) The fish is as fresh as you can get, having just been caught by the retired fisherman owner of the place. The pool is just gorgeous, also spotlessly clean, and there is terrific snorkeling immediately in front of the hotel (although entry via the rocky beach can be a bit challenging). Bottled water provided in your room. Air conditioning, comfortable beds, plenty of fluffy towels---there is nothing you will want for. The entire place is meticulously maintained; we loved the outdoor private shower. Everything is open-air, so you do have to contend with a bit of nature (depending on the season) such as caterpillars or lizards. The beds are equipped with mosquito nets but we didn't encounter mosquitoes during our February stay. Some rooms have stairs, but there are others that don't, and it's beach-level so it's good for people who don't want to climb all the stairs of some of the other Amed resorts. The upstairs waterfront honeymoon suite, which we didn't book this time, is spectacular and we hope to book it when we come back. Super-nice people with impeccable customer service. Note though that this is a child-free hotel! We anticipated exploring the rest of Amed but we loved this place so much we hardly left, and we extended our stay a day.
